diff options
Diffstat (limited to 'src/bluez-call.c')
-rw-r--r-- | src/bluez-call.c |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/src/bluez-call.c b/src/bluez-call.c index 86f9b9c..5c0fc77 100644 --- a/src/bluez-call.c +++ b/src/bluez-call.c @@ -229,6 +229,8 @@ bluez_call_async(struct bluez_state *ns, } cpw->callback = callback; + DEBUG("calling %s:%s:%s on %s:%s", + interface, method, params, BLUEZ_SERVICE, path); g_dbus_connection_call(ns->conn, BLUEZ_SERVICE, path, interface, method, params, NULL, /* reply type */ @@ -281,6 +283,8 @@ GVariant *bluez_get_properties(struct bluez_state *ns, return NULL; } + DEBUG("calling %s:%s:%s on %s:%s", + interface, method, interface2, BLUEZ_SERVICE, path); reply = g_dbus_connection_call_sync(ns->conn, BLUEZ_SERVICE, path, interface, method, interface2 ? g_variant_new("(s)", interface2) : NULL, @@ -443,8 +447,8 @@ gboolean bluez_autoconnect(gpointer data) gboolean paired = FALSE; if (g_variant_dict_lookup(props_dict, "Paired", "b", &paired) && paired) { - gchar *path = g_strconcat("/org/bluez/", adapter, "/", key, NULL); - GVariant *connect_reply = bluez_call(ns, "device", path, "Connect", NULL, NULL); + gchar *path = g_strconcat(adapter, "/", key, NULL); + GVariant *connect_reply = bluez_call(ns, BLUEZ_AT_DEVICE, path, "Connect", NULL, NULL); g_free(path); if (!connect_reply) continue; |